Mounted Lens Exports

Exports from Sweden

In value terms, mounted lens exports contracted to $X in 2022. In general, exports posted a prominent incre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 37%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of $X, and then contracted in the following year.

Exports by Country

In value terms, the largest markets for mounted lens exported from Sweden were Finland ($X), the United States ($X) and Germany ($X), with a combined 54% share of total exports. The Netherlands, Norway, Taiwan (Chinese), Japan, Poland, Denmark, Switzerland, France, the UK and the Czech Republic l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 29%.

In terms of the main countries of destination, the Czech Republic, with a CAGR of +83.7%, saw the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of exports, over the period under review, while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Mounted Lens Imports

Imports into Sweden

In value terms, mounted lens imports skyrocketed to $X in 2022. Overall, imports recorded a prominent incre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2017 when imports increased by 82% against the previous year. Imports peaked at $X in 2018; however, from 2019 to 2022, imports remained at a lower figure.

Imports by Country

In value terms, Singapore ($X), Switzerland ($X) and the Czech Republic ($X) constituted the largest mounted lens suppliers to Sweden, together comprising 53% of total imports.

The Czech Republic, with a CAGR of +95.4%, saw the highest growth rate of the value of imports, in terms of the main suppliers over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
